Across TCGA patient cohorts, TRAV9-1 mutation is significantly associated with the RNA expression of many other genes, with 185 significant associations in total. SKCM shows the largest number of these associations.

The most reproducible TRAV9-1-associated genes across cancer lineages are SNORD111B, KCNH1-IT1, and MTCO2P11. Each is linked with TRAV9-1 in more than 1 cancer types. Because this analysis shows association rather than direction, both TRAV9-1-to-partner and partner-to-TRAV9-1 results are reported.
